#Diesel: Surprisingly, Suzuki has opted to use the 75PS version of Fiat’s Multijet in the Baleno instead of the 90PS version that it uses in the Ciaz, Ertiga & S-cross. Ride Quality and Handling: Baleno has a much more grown up setup than the Dzire in terms of dynamics. It has a slightly softer springs which coupled to the long wheelbase has resulted in a pliant and more comfortable ride quality than the Dzire.
